Unified mobile platforms have developed systems where activity in slot games feeds directly into sports event prediction modules and the reverse also occurs. These frameworks track player actions across both formats and convert spins, wins, or losses into points that unlock features in the sports side while prediction accuracy or participation affects slot bonuses.

Core Mechanics Behind Cross-Game Progression

Developers design shared ledgers that record every slot spin as data points and translate those into prediction credits while successful sports forecasts generate multipliers for slot sessions. One platform might award progression tokens after a set number of spins and allow users to spend those tokens on higher-stakes predictions for upcoming matches. Data collected through these loops shows consistent patterns where players who complete daily slot challenges receive boosted odds visibility in the sports section.

Systems often employ tiered levels that rise based on combined activity and researchers at institutions such as the University of Nevada Reno Gaming Research Center have documented how these tiers unlock shared leaderboards. The structure keeps users moving between sections because progress in one directly influences rewards in the other and operators report sustained session lengths when the linkage remains visible on screen.

Technical Infrastructure Supporting the Linkages

Backend databases store progression variables in unified profiles that sync across devices and update in real time when a slot session ends or a prediction resolves. Application programming interfaces connect the slot engine to the sports module so that token values adjust automatically based on current event odds. Security protocols encrypt these transfers and compliance teams review the flows to meet standards set by bodies such as the Nevada Gaming Control Board and the Australian Communications and Media Authority.

Updates rolled out in mid-2026 introduced dynamic scaling where high-volume slot users receive temporary prediction boosts during live events and the change increased overall engagement metrics across tested platforms. Engineers continue to refine the algorithms that balance point distribution so neither side dominates the progression economy.
